DaBaby gets put in the hot seat in the premiere episode of UPROXX’s brand new series Sound Check.

Hosted by HipHopDX‘s own Jeremy Hecht, the quickfire round show challenges guests to choose between two songs from some of their favorite artists, shedding light on their musical tastes and influences while uncovering never-before-heard stories from their early lives and careers.

AD

AD LOADING...

In the first episode, which premiered on Wednesday (March 19), DaBaby is forced to make some tough decisions as he’s asked to pick either Fat Joe‘s “Lean Back” or Mary J. Blige‘s “Family Affair,” Eminem‘s “Till I Collapse” or 2Pac‘s “All Eyez On Me,” and Snoop Dogg‘s “Drop It Like It’s Hot” or Future‘s “Mask Off,” among others.

The most “stressful” moment, however, comes when the North Carolina-bred rap star is presented with defining hits from two of his favorite rappers: “Ride Wit Me” by Nelly and “In Da Club” by 50 Cent.

“Now why the fuck would you do that?” DaBaby jokingly asks Jeremy while struggling to pick a winner. “Nelly ‘Ride Wit Me’ is… but 50 Cent ‘In Da Club’? Trying to hang upside down in the living room with the durag on and the wife beater? Oh my God. Both of them have been my favorite rappers for an extended period of time.”

Ultimately, the “Suge” MC couldn’t separate the two songs and uses his sole lifeline to call it a tie.

Later in the episode, the spotlight is turned on DaBaby’s own catalog as he is asked which was more difficult to write between “In a Minute” and the intro to his 2017 album KIRK, two of his most heartfelt tracks.

“I’ma go ‘Intro,'” he answers. “I made that when my father passed and when I first popped as a mainstream artist. ‘In a Minute’ was more therapeutic — both of them were therapeutic — but ‘In a Minute’ was more reflective, like me just sitting back and looking at my journey, just really analyzing the obstacles I’ve navigated through and how I’m still here.”

In the final round, Jeremy flips the script and must guess DaBaby’s “lifetime anthem” between a song he had previously written down and a decoy track selected by producers.

Is it Nas‘ “The World Is Yours” or Mark Morrison‘s “Return of the Mack”? Watch the episode below to see if Jeremy guessed right.
